Johnson to step down at Sto-Rox

Updated: Jan 3, 2022


-FOOTBALL-


LaRoi Johnson has announced plans to step down as Sto-Rox athletic director and head football coach after four seasons with the district.


Johnson, who has led the Vikings to the WPIAL playoffs three times since his head coach appointment in 2018, issued a short statement on social media announcing his departure. He did not respond to requests for further comment.


“I want to first say thank you to everyone who has been a part of the last four years,” his statement said. “It was an honor to be your Head Coach the last 4 seasons. To every student athlete I coached I thank you for all of your efforts. I will love you always and will be in your corner forever.”

After finishing WPIAL runners-up in consecutive seasons, Johnson was promoted to athletic director in June 2020. Once hired, Johnson replaced several longtime coaches with external recruits and articulated plans to build a new athletic culture from the ground up.


Cameron Culliver, school board president, said he wants Johnson’s successor to continue the momentum.


“As we move forward in looking for new personnel, I do hope some of the things Coach Johnson has started will continue and the next person continues to make things better,” Culliver said.


“I would like to wish Coach Johnson luck in his future endeavors and I hope he realizes the impacts he has made to this community.”
